So, what exactly is an EPOS terminal? An EPOS terminal is a computerized system that allows retailers to process transactions, track inventory, and gather valuable data about customer preferences and buying habits These terminals typically consist of a touchscreen monitor, a barcode scanner, a receipt printer, and a cash drawer, all of which are connected to a central computer system This system enables retailers to streamline their operations and provide a seamless shopping experience for customers.
